What is this site?

This site has been set up by the EU to help unsatisfied customers. You can use it to make a complaint about a good or service you bought over the internet and find a neutral third party ("dispute resolution body") to handle the dispute. In some countries, traders are allowed to submit complaints about consumers. If this applies to your country, as a trader you will be able to use this system to complain about a consumer.

The resolution bodies listed on this site have all been checked to make sure that they meet our standards and are registered with the national authorities.

What is alternative dispute resolution?

If you have a complaint about a purchase, instead of going to court, you could opt for alternative dispute resolution. Alternative dispute resolution is the term used to describe all the different ways of resolving a complaint that don't involve going to court. Typically what happens is that you ask a neutral third party to step in and act as an intermediary between you and the trader you're complaining about. The intermediary might suggest a solution to your complaint, impose a solution on you and the other party or just bring you both together to discuss how to find a solution. You might know alternative dispute resolution as "mediation", "conciliation", "arbitration", "ombudsman" or "complaints' board". Compared with going to court, alternative dispute resolution usually costs less, is less formal and quicker.

What is online dispute resolution?

If you have a complaint about a purchase and you don't want to have to go to court, you may be able to use online dispute resolution to reach an out-of-court settlement.

Using our website, you and the trader you are complaining about can find a dispute resolution body, then go through the process of finding a solution to your complaint. Important: you can only use this system if your complaint is about an online purchase.
